The Quantum Mirror: A Spy's Dilemma

The moon hung low in the sky, casting a silver glow over the sleek, futuristic building that housed the clandestine organization known as The Quantum. Inside, the air was thick with tension as Agent Kaelan, a man of few words and even fewer friends, sat across from his superior, Agent Rylan.

Kaelan had been a spy for years, a master of disguise and deception. But the mission he was currently on was different. It was personal. He had been sent to infiltrate the ranks of a rival organization, a group that had been rumored to be developing a device capable of altering the fabric of reality.

Rylan, a man with a calm demeanor and piercing blue eyes, leaned forward. "You know the risks, Kaelan. If they figure out who you are, it could mean the end of both of us."

Kaelan nodded, his gaze steady. "I know. But I can't just walk away. Not when the fate of the world hangs in the balance."

Rylan sighed. "I understand your dedication, Kaelan, but this is a different kind of mission. You're not just a spy anymore. You're a man with a past, a man with a heart."

Kaelan's eyes flickered with a hint of pain. "I've tried to leave that behind. But it's always there, like a ghost that won't let go."

The door to the office opened, and in walked a young man with a nervous smile. "Agent Rylan, Agent Kaelan, I have the latest intelligence on the rival organization. They've been moving faster than expected."

Rylan nodded, taking the report. "Thank you, Agent Chen. Kaelan, you need to be extra cautious. The closer you get to the truth, the more dangerous it becomes."

Kaelan stood up, his movements fluid and precise. "I'll be careful, Rylan. But I need to know one thing. What if the device is real? What if we can change the very nature of reality?"

Rylan's eyes softened. "That's the question we're all asking ourselves, Kaelan. But remember, with great power comes great responsibility. You must choose wisely."

As Kaelan left the office, he couldn't shake the feeling that something was off. He had been on countless missions, but this one felt different. There was a man, a target, who had been haunting his dreams. He couldn't quite place him, but the man's face was seared into his memory.

Days turned into weeks as Kaelan delved deeper into the ranks of the rival organization. He used his skills to uncover secrets and gather information, all the while keeping his true identity hidden. But as he got closer to the truth, he began to realize that the man from his dreams was more than just a target. He was someone he had a connection with, someone he couldn't walk away from.

One evening, as Kaelan was on a routine surveillance assignment, he saw the man from his dreams standing in the shadows. He watched, frozen, as the man approached a window and looked out, his expression one of longing and sorrow.

Kaelan's heart raced. He had to know who this man was. He followed him, using his quick-change abilities to remain unseen. The man led him to a secluded room, where he revealed his true identity: Agent Leo, a fellow spy who had been working for the rival organization.

Leo's eyes met Kaelan's, filled with a mix of fear and desperation. "I didn't want to be a part of this," he whispered. "But they threatened my family. They said they would hurt them if I didn't cooperate."

Kaelan's heart ached. He had never been able to save anyone before. But now, he had a chance. He could help Leo, he could help his family.

As they spoke, a sudden explosion shattered the room. Kaelan and Leo were thrown to the ground, the blast knocking them unconscious.

When they woke up, they found themselves in a different part of the building. They were surrounded by agents from the rival organization, and there was no escape.

Kaelan looked at Leo, his eyes filled with determination. "We have to get out of here," he said, standing up.

Leo nodded, his face pale but resolute. "I trust you."

Kaelan took a deep breath, preparing himself for the fight that lay ahead. But as he looked around, he saw something that surprised him. The agents were not just agents. They were his friends, his colleagues, people he had once trusted.

The realization hit him like a physical blow. He had been manipulated, used as a pawn in a game he didn't understand. But now, he had a choice. He could fight for the organization he had once served, or he could fight for the truth.

As the agents moved in, Kaelan and Leo faced them together, their bond stronger than ever. They were not just spies anymore. They were men who had found their identities, who had found each other.

In the end, they managed to escape, but not without paying a heavy price. Kaelan had to confront the reality of his past and the choices he had made. Leo had to face the truth about his own loyalties.

The Quantum Mirror: A Spy's Dilemma was not just a story of espionage and intrigue. It was a story of love, loss, and the struggle to find one's true self in a world where appearances could be deceiving.
